The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A) is Australia's primary legislation governing online gambling. Under the IGA, it is illegal for Australian-based companies to offer real-money interactive gambling services, including online pokies, to Australian residents. However — and this is the critical distinction — the IGA does not prohibit Australian players from accessing or using offshore-licensed gambling sites. Because the law targets operators, not players, thousands of Australians legally play at licensed international online casinos every day without any legal consequences.
No Australian player has ever been prosecuted for playing at a licensed offshore pokies site. The law's enforcement focus is on unlicensed Australian operators, not individual players choosing to access regulated international platforms.
Offshore casinos holding licences from recognised regulators — including the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), Curaçao eGaming, Kahnawake Gaming Commission, and Gibraltar Regulatory Authority — are authorised to accept Australian players under their own jurisdictions. These licences impose strict standards: RNG certification, player fund segregation, responsible gambling tools, and mandatory audit schedules by independent laboratories such as eCOGRA and iTech Labs.

Real money pokies in Australia work the same as physical pokie machines found in clubs and pubs across the country — you spin the reels, and a certified random number generator (RNG) determines the outcome. The key difference is RTP (Return to Player) rate. Online pokies typically carry RTPs of 95–98%, significantly higher than land-based machines which average around 85–90%. This mathematical advantage makes online pokies genuinely better value for real money play.
Top online pokies platforms offer RTPs of 96–98%, compared to 85% average at land-based venues. Over 1,000 spins, a 96% RTP means $960 returned per $1,000 wagered on average — a significant real-money advantage for informed players.

Verify the gaming licence: Every safe pokies site prominently displays its licence number in the footer. Cross-reference the number directly on the regulator's website (MGA, Curaçao eGaming, or Kahnawake). A legitimate licence means player funds are protected and games are independently audited.
Check RNG certification: Look for e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I (Gaming Laboratories International) seals. These independent labs verify that pokie RNGs are genuinely random and that stated RTPs are accurate. Without this certification, you have no guarantee of fair outcomes.
Confirm SSL encryption: Your browser should show a padlock icon and "https://" in the URL. This indicates 256-bit SSL encryption protecting your personal and financial information. Never deposit on a site without active SSL.
Read the withdrawal policy: Before depositing, locate the site's withdrawal terms. The best pokies platforms for real money in Australia process withdrawals in under 24 hours with no excessive verification delays. Avoid sites requiring more than 5 business days for standard withdrawals.
Test customer support: Contact live chat before registering. A licensed, professional site responds in under 2 minutes with knowledgeable, helpful agents. Slow or evasive responses before you've deposited signal problems you'll encounter after.
Assess responsible gambling tools: Regulated sites are required to offer deposit limits, session time limits, self-exclusion options, and links to gambling support services. The presence of robust RG tools is a direct indicator of regulatory compliance.
Review the bonus terms carefully: Beginner-friendly pokies sites present their bonus terms clearly — no hidden conditions, no impossible wagering requirements. Standard wagering in Australia ranges from 25x to 40x; anything above 60x should be avoided.

Australian PayID is a payment identifier system operated through Australia's New Payments Platform (NPP), allowing real-time bank transfers using your phone number, email address, or ABN as your identifier rather than BSB and account numbers. For online pokies players, this means deposits clear in under 60 seconds from any participating Australian bank — including the big four (Commonwealth, NAB, ANZ, Westpac) and all major digital banks. For instant pokies withdrawal, PayID is currently the fastest available option at licensed sites. The same PayID address used for deposits typically enables same-method withdrawals, with funds returning to your bank account in 1–4 hours after the casino processes the request. Verification (KYC) is required for first withdrawals — have your driver's licence or passport and a recent utility bill ready to reduce processing time. Sites that delay KYC without limit or request unnecessary documents are red flags regardless of their licence status.

A no-deposit bonus is credit or free spins credited to your account upon registration — no payment required. For Australian players new to online pokies, this is a significant opportunity: you can spin real licensed pokies, experience actual game mechanics, and even win real money without depositing a single dollar. The catch, as with all casino bonuses, is wagering requirements: no-deposit winnings must typically be wagered 30–60 times before withdrawal.
